CVE-2023-25647 is a low-severity vulnerability rated 3.3/10 on the CVSS scale. There is a permission and access control vulnerability in some ZTE mobile phones. Due to improper access control, applications in mobile phone could monitor the touch event. . EPSS estimates a 0.19%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.

Affected Software

VendorProductVersions
ZteAxon 30 Firmware< 3.0.0b06
ZteAxon 40 Pro Firmware< 1.0.0b16
ZteAxon 40 Ultra Firmware< 2.0.0b17
ZteNubia Z50 Firmware< 1.0.0b19mr
